On Fri, Jun 01, 2007 at 12:40:30PM -0500, Patrick R. Michaud wrote:
> I'm not so sure it would make much of a difference.  What did you have 
> $DiffKeepDays set to before the file "exploded"?  What would be the
> benefit of
> 
>    "if any file grows beyond a certain size, apply $DiffKeepDays=180"
> 
> versus simply
> 
>    "apply $DiffKeepDays=180"

Because he doesn't want to lose the history for pages that have *not*
changed a lot.  If one has a blanket "$DiffKeepDays" value, say if one
had a $DiffKeepDays value of 50, then a page that was last changed two
months ago would lose all of its history.  The problem is that there
appears to be a mixture of some pages that are changing a lot, and other
pages that aren't.

Thus, what is wanted is some way of "trimming" the history only when the
history becomes unmanageable, and keeping it otherwise.
